Friedensreich Hundertwasser: “The thingamajig grows in the flowerpot”
Hundertwasser used color instinctively (according to the renowned art historian Wieland Schmied) and, precisely because of this, achieved maximum effect with almost sleepwalking certainty. The deep black lacquered solid wood frame and the black passe-partout with its white beveled edge make his colors shine all the more brightly.
High-quality reproduction, finishing with glossy foil and the matte black background emphasize the value.
Format 59 x 59 cm.
